STATE v. BALL

C83-07-33480; CA A36004.

731 P.2d 1048 (1987)

83 Or.App. 320

STATE of Oregon, Respondent, v. Ronald Lee BALL, Appellant.

Court of Appeals of Oregon.

Decided January 21, 1987.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Gary D. Babcock, Public Defender, Salem, filed the brief on remand for appellant. With him was John P. Daugirda, Deputy Public Defender, Salem.

Dave Frohnmayer, Atty. Gen., Salem, filed the brief for respondent. With him were James E. Mountain, Jr., Sol. Gen., and Thomas H. Denney, Asst. Atty. Gen., Salem.

Before, WARDEN, P.J., and VAN HOOMISSEN and YOUNG, JJ.


PER CURIAM.

This case is before us on remand. State v. Ball, 302 Or. 298, 729 P.2d 551 (1986). In State v. Ball, 77 Or.App. 308, 711 P.2d 988 (1986), we reversed defendant's convictions for possession of controlled substances on the authority of State v. Westlund, 75 Or.App. 43...
